    Position Summary:

    We are seeking an experienced, reliable HVACR Technician to install, maintain, troubleshoot, and repair heating, ventilation, air conditioning, and refrigeration systems for commercial and/or residential clients. The ideal candidate is safety-focused, customer-oriented, and able to work independently in the field.

    Key Responsibilities:

    • Diagnose, repair, and perform preventative maintenance on HVAC and refrigeration systems (rooftop units, split systems, furnaces, heat pumps, walk-in coolers, ice machines, etc.).
    • Install new HVACR equipment per manufacturer specs and local codes.
    • Read and interpret schematics, wiring diagrams, and equipment manuals.
    • Perform brazing, piping, wiring, refrigerant recovery/charging, and system balancing.
    • Complete work orders, and communicate status with dispatch and customers.
    • Follow safety protocols, maintain clean work areas, and use PPE.
    • Provide clear, professional customer interaction and explain repairs/recommendations.

    Qualifications:

    • 5 years of hands-on HVACR field experience (commercial experience preferred ).
    • EPA Section 608 certification (Universal).
    • Strong electrical troubleshooting skills; ability to read wiring diagrams and use multimeter.
    • Experience with refrigerants, recovery equipment, and leak detection.
    • Valid driver’s license and clean driving record.
    • Ability to lift 50+ lbs, work in confined spaces, and handle varied environmental conditions.
    • Excellent customer service, communication, and time-management skills.

    Desired Certifications (a plus):

    • Manufacturer-specific certifications (Carrier, Trane, Daikin, etc.)
